[PATCH 01/20] ASoC: adau1372: Unwind failed power restoration

adau1372_set_power() enables MCLK and optional PLL state before
restoring the clock-control register and register cache. The final two
operations are unchecked, so the DAPM bias callback can report STANDBY
while hardware restoration is incomplete.
Check the clock-control update and cache replay. Reuse one failure path
for PLL, register and cache errors that powers the device back down,
restores cache-only and dirty state, and disables MCLK.
The issue was identified via static analysis and manually reviewed.
